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
258991041 42274792261 26439959
7718 610515130
7718 610515130
66 29360210015 43
All about undefined
Interested in learning more?
7718 610515130
66 29360210015 43
See more
727 4815699893 62650337
223919 328507913 57158452122
See more
461 83478197
70823361694 631728400 6904306
See more